Keble Court

This courtyard development of 72 assisted-living apartments offers first-class facilities and stunning spaces including café, lounge, hair and beauty salon, assisted spa and manicured gardens.

The new 3-storey building is fully wheelchair accessible.  The design includes visual references to the local architectural vernacular of brickwork, render, tiled roofs, dormer windows and weatherboarding. Balconies are provided for most of the upper floor apartments.

Designed as a masonary construction, but changed later in the design process to fusion light gauge steel.  This resulted in an overall  increase in sales area.

The south-facing internal courtyard allows sunlight into most of the dwellings and views across to the badger setts on the adjoining site. Sensory mixed planting will provide year-round interest for residents. A central feature tree with a circular wooden bench and up-lighting provide further interest as well as a community landmark and meeting point.

To the south of the courtyard, a semi-enclosed, walled allotment garden with shed is available for use by residents.
